So my faithful CME2821 has gone the way of the dodo bird.  I have to get a new system installed stat.  I found a Cisco partner and they recommended the ISR-4331.  Now I find out I would have to buy about and extra 4-5 worth of equipment and licenses to get it to were my cme/cue is.

I see there is a BE6000s out there that may be the ticket.

This is what I have/need:

 8 POTS lines coming in

35 users

Voicemail

email notification for voicemails

It would be cool if I could get instant messaging and video conferencing

Also is the BE6000s heading for EOL in the next 5 years?

Your 2821 Might be end of life, doesnt mean it is gonna fall over. 

Upgrading to the 4000 ISR, might make sense if you want a device that has any development on it for the next couple years. But if you do not require any additional features that the 2821 hasnt already got, why would you upgrade?  You could get a cold standby spare 282,1 in case it does fall over.

There are always options.
